Resume Format for BTech Freshers 2025

ATS-friendly resume templates for every engineering branch — CS, IT, ECE, EEE, Mechanical

Last updated: March 1, 2026

As a BTech fresher in India, your resume is your first impression with companies like TCS, Infosys, Wipro, Cognizant, and hundreds of startups hiring from campuses. The problem? Most engineering students use the same generic Word template their seniors passed down, which often fails ATS screening and doesn't highlight what recruiters actually look for. Your resume needs to be ATS-optimized, one page, and structured to show your technical skills, academic projects, and CGPA prominently — not buried under irrelevant sections. FresherResume gives you free, professionally designed templates built specifically for Indian BTech freshers, with AI-powered suggestions to fill each section.

Why BTech Freshers Need a Different Resume Format

A fresher resume is fundamentally different from an experienced professional's resume. You're not showing career progression — you're showing potential. Recruiters evaluating freshers focus on academic performance, projects, skills, and certifications.

  • Education section comes right after the career objective (not at the bottom)
  • Projects section replaces the Experience section as the main body
  • Skills section should mirror the job description keywords exactly
  • No need for a professional summary — a 2-line objective is sufficient
  • Certifications and achievements fill the space where job history would go

Resume Format by Engineering Branch

While the resume structure stays the same, the keywords and project types differ by branch. Here's what to emphasize based on your BTech specialization.

  • CS/IT: DSA, OOP, DBMS, Web Development, ML, Cloud — strongest demand for campus hiring
  • ECE: Embedded Systems, VLSI, Signal Processing, IoT, Python, MATLAB
  • EEE: Power Systems, Control Systems, PLC/SCADA, MATLAB, Renewable Energy
  • Mechanical: AutoCAD, SolidWorks, Thermodynamics, Manufacturing, Six Sigma
  • Civil: AutoCAD, STAAD Pro, Surveying, Project Management, LEED

The Perfect Project Description (With Examples)

Projects are the most scrutinized section for freshers. Here's a formula that works for ATS and interviewers: Action Verb + What You Built + Technology + Quantified Outcome.

  • 'Developed a student attendance system using Python and OpenCV with 95% accuracy'
  • 'Built an e-commerce REST API using Node.js and MongoDB handling 500+ products'
  • 'Designed a weather forecasting model using LSTM networks with 88% prediction accuracy'
  • 'Created a portfolio website using React and Tailwind CSS, deployed on Vercel'
  • 'Implemented a chat application using Socket.io supporting 50+ concurrent users'

Certifications That Matter for BTech Freshers

Certifications show initiative and self-learning ability. Focus on certifications from recognized platforms that Indian recruiters value.

  • NPTEL (IIT/IISc courses) — highly recognized in Indian academia and industry
  • Coursera (Google, IBM, Meta certificates) — globally recognized
  • AWS/Azure/GCP Cloud Practitioner — shows modern tech awareness
  • HackerRank/LeetCode profile — link your coding profiles with ratings
  • Company-specific: TCS NQT, InfyTQ, Wipro TalentNext — direct hiring pipelines

Ready to Build Your Resume?

47+ ATS-friendly templates. Free to create. Takes 10 minutes.

Essential ATS Keywords to Include

Include these keywords naturally in your resume to pass ATS screening.

Universal Technical Skills

JavaPythonC/C++SQLJavaScriptHTML/CSSGitLinux

CS/IT Specific

DSAOOPDBMSOSComputer NetworksWeb DevelopmentREST APIMachine Learning

Development Practices

SDLCAgileVersion ControlTestingDebuggingCI/CD

Frameworks & Tools

ReactNode.jsMongoDBMySQLAWSDockerTensorFlow

Frequently Asked Questions

What is the best resume format for BTech freshers in India?

The best format is a single-page, single-column resume with sections in this order: Contact Info, Career Objective, Education (with CGPA), Technical Skills, Projects, Certifications, Achievements. Use a clean font like Arial or Calibri, and save as PDF. Avoid multi-column or graphical designs.

How long should a BTech fresher resume be?

Strictly one page. As a fresher, you don't have enough experience to justify two pages. Recruiters spend 6-10 seconds scanning a resume. A concise, well-structured single-page resume is far more effective than a padded two-page one.

Should BTech freshers include 10th and 12th marks?

Yes, for Indian campus placements and mass recruiters like TCS, Infosys, and Wipro, 10th and 12th marks are mandatory. These companies have minimum percentage cutoffs (usually 60%) and will reject resumes that don't show these scores.

What if I don't have any internship experience?

Focus on your projects section instead. List 2-3 academic or personal projects with tech stack, your role, and measurable outcomes. Also add certifications from platforms like Coursera, NPTEL, or Udemy. Hackathon participation and open-source contributions also substitute well for internship experience.

Should I create different resumes for different companies?

Yes. Each company uses different ATS keywords. A resume for TCS should emphasize Java, SDLC, and software testing, while Infosys values Python, Full Stack, and ML. FresherResume lets you create multiple resume versions and tailor keywords for each company's JD.

Build Your BTech Resume in 10 Minutes — Free

Free to create. ATS-optimized templates. Built for Indian freshers.